Here’s a look at what’s coming to everyone who owns the game:
FREE DLC CONTENT
5 more heroes, bringing the total to 30
Alani – released May 31st, 2016
Pendles – coming soon in July
Three more heroes to be revealed in late Summer through the Fall
Three new PVP Maps in the next couple of weeks, one for each mode
Broadcaster Mode coming hopefully next month
Broadcaster mode will allow you to spectate the battlefield using a set of third-person camera controls to follow players on either team, jump to points of interest, or to move freely around the battlefield in Private Versus Matches.
In-game Reporting, our goal is to include it in the next major patch update for July
In the interest of making it easier to report players who are trying to ruin the fun for everyone, we’ve created an in-game reporting function that will be accessible through the scoreboard and allow you to flag players who are suspected of cheating, abandoning games, or ruining the overall experience.
Matchmaking Adjustments: Ongoing
We regularly adjust and tweak matchmaking parameters in order to keep improving the matchmaking process. In fact, we’ll be testing out an overhaul to the matchmaking system starting later this week.
Hero Balancing: Ongoing
As we gather data from matches and mission, we’ll continue to adjust and refine hero balance in the game. You can expect a bigger adjustment to 24 of the 26 characters likely coming in the next couple of weeks.
Lore Challenges: Upcoming major patch
We are working on adjustments to lore requirements as well as how those requirements are tracked.

PREMIUM DLC CONTENT Premium DLC content includes DLC packs 1 through 5, each with a playable Story Operation and unlockable skins and taunts, as well as early access to heroes 26 through 30 with the use of a hero key.
Premium DLC Timeline:
Alani early access with hero key started May 24, 2016
Pendles early access with hero key in mid-Summer
Each DLC Story Operation release includes new, unlockable skins and taunts
DLC 1 Story Operation “Attikus and the Thrall Rebellion” coming late Summer
Heroes 28 – 30 early access, each with a hero key, coming mid-Summer through the Fall
DLC 2 Story Operation around late Summer
DLC 3 Story Operation coming early Fall
DLC 4 Story Operation coming late Fall
DLC 5 Story Operation coming this Winter
The first DLC Story Operation features Attikus and his twisted recount of the thrall rebellion he led to overthrow his Jennerit oppressors. Each DLC Story Operation is a highly-replayable scenario featuring one of Battleborn’s heroes. Each time you play through an Operation, the story, enemies, and objectives will change, increasing the difficulty but also the rewarded loot.
Along with each Story Operation comes new skins and taunts that can only be unlocked through playing the Operation. Each set will include skins and taunts for various characters and will not be available to purchase individually in the Marketplace.
Additionally, Season Pass holders will also get early access to heroes 26 through 30 with the use of a hero key. Each hero’s early access period will come with a hero key that can be used on the new hero, or any other locked Battleborn. Hero keys bypass challenge or credit requirements for unlocking heroes.
THE BATTLEBORN MARKETPLACE The Battleborn Marketplace offers players the option to use earned or paid in-game currency to enhance their game experience without affecting gameplay. The Marketplace houses a variety of in-game content, from Loot Packs, bank pages, and new heroes that can be purchased with Credits earned in-game, to premium cosmetic skins and taunts that can be purchased with paid Platinum currency.
We recently introduced Platinum to the Marketplace, a premium currency that can be purchased through the PlayStation Store, the Xbox Store, or through Steam Wallet in-game. Platinum can be used to purchase cosmetic skins and taunts that are not available to unlock or earn as dropped loot, or pick extra bank spaces or Loadouts.

With a passion for witchcraft and a touch of gunpowder, we’re proud to present to you… the Gun Witch! Using Broom Power, a magically regenerating resource, the Gun Witch has no need for blue mana and can use all her powers at will. With abilities and witchcraft spells, the Gun Witch can fly from spot to spot, hovering in the air as she snipes enemies on the ground. Meet the Gun Witch in the video above for a full overview!
Hero Buffs
It’s time for the four main heroes to get a boost! These updates will bring the original heroes to Abyss Lord and Series EV2 power level. When the patch comes out in July, you’ll be able to check out all the nitty-gritty details in the patch notes. Here’s a preview of some of the notes: RPG PATCH NOTES.
We’re buffing the Apprentice to increase the damage viability of his defenses, giving him a tankier Arcane Barrier, and drastically reducing his ability cooldowns so they’re fun to use frequently.
We’re making the Squire a more viable melee and ability power fighter. We’ll be making both of his blockades sturdier and increase the damage of all of his defenses. We're also experimenting with removing root motion, so you can move and attack at the same time.
We’ve modified each of the Monk’s melee attacks to make his polearm types more unique. We’ve also boosted the damage output of his damage dealing towers and boosting ability of his Boost Aura.
We’ve reduced the cooldowns and increased the damage on many of the Huntress’s abilities. We gave all of her traps a substantial damage boost and modified the Poison Dart Tower so it’s more effective on the battlefield.
Game Browser
We’ve made a ton of changes to how you play maps and create games in the Power Up update! With the new Game Browser, you can now see every game being played. No more jumping blindly into a game hoping to find other players! Use the map, mode and difficulty filters to find the open games you want to play, or create your own. Entice players to join you by adding a custom name to your game. With the minimum iPWR filter, you can make sure the right people are joining your games. Based on your feedback, we’ll add more filters and settings to make sure finding and playing with other players is an enjoyable experience.
We’ve also restructured the game into three game modes: Campaign, Challenges (previously called Incursions), and Onslaught. All of these modes are unlocked from the beginning. Each mode now contains the following difficulties: Normal, Hard, Expert, Insane, and Nightmare I - IV. Thanks to your Influence Vote, Normal and Hard are both unlocked from the beginning, and the other difficulties unlock as your heroes’ level increases.
Passive Updates
Since we’ll be powering up the main four heroes, we also wanted to do a balance pass on many of the passives and legendary weapons in the game. In many cases we have combined passives that previously appeared on many items to a single passive that rolls on a single item. These new items will be guaranteed drops on specific maps.
Our end goal: The ability to target farm the gear you need to make your heroes awesome!
